1 ene 1213 año aC - Merenptah Sends Grain to Hittites

Descripción:

WIREs Clim Change 2015. doi: 10.1002/wcc.345
Drought and societal collapse
3200 years ago in the Eastern
Mediterranean: a review
David Kaniewski,1,2,3∗ Joël Guiot4 and Elise Van Campo1,2

At the very end of the 13th century BCE, Pharaoh Merenptah (first regnal year: 1226–1215 cal year BCE40) sent the earliest known shipment of grains in the form of famine aid3,26 to the Hittites. This vital import of food had reached sizable proportions, as revealed by the words ‘grain to be taken in ships, to keep alive this land of Hatti’ (KRI IV 5.3).
